Position Information Position Title Interior Design Adjunct Instructor Requisition Number A00092P Job Summary/Basic Function Teaching undergraduate students in the field of interior design and managing the class syllabus and ensuring that the syllabus meets program, accreditation, department and university standards. Planning and creating lectures, in-class discussions and assignments. Grading assigned papers, quizzes and exams. Assessing grades for students based on participation, performance in class, assignments and examinations. Collaborating with colleagues on course curriculum. Participation in program activities, events and accreditation. Ongoing continuing education in the field of interior design. Required Qualifications Bachelor's degree in Interior Design from a CIDA accredited four-year program and minimum of 2 years professional and/or teaching experience. Preferred Qualifications Master's degree in Interior Design, Interior Architecture, Architecture, Fine Arts, Education or like field, having at least one degree in Interior Design. NCIDQ certification or ongoing pursuit of professional certification. Background Check?
